The Umbrella Academy: Tom Hopper and Emmy Laborampman break through the darkest moments of Season 3

Literally the end of the world, multiple death scenes, a television season that includes mild elder abuse, Umbrella's Darkest Moment AcademySeason 3 will take place in episode 5, "Kindest Cut." Written by Elizabeth Padden and directed by Sylvian White — and Spoilers beyond this point— Broken Allison (Emmy Raver-Lampman) uses her power Use to try to put Luther (Tom Hopper) to sleep with her, going to the point of kissing him against his will.

"The scene was really rewarding in the best possible way," Raver-Lampman told Decider. "Sylvain White and Tom, who oversaw us in that episode, and our incredible camera crew were all really aware of the subject and sensitive."

Just before the rape. It stops at, but it certainly approaches and can be easily classified as an assault. It's the moment it's placed on the page, but it's open to interpretation, and Hopper states that "it can go in different ways."

"The script says Alison is approaching Luther. It's all physical ... she's imminent on him," Hopper continued. "Through the rehearsals, we felt like she wanted to regain power. She says," No, I'm out of control and I want to control the situation again. . I need to control something. "And she just stood there and said it. And she had all the power against this big man, Luther.

Throughout the season up to this point, Alison has steadily collapsed mentally, but her power has grown physically. It all stems from the revelation in the second episode of the season. Allison discovered that the new timeline the team traveled to did not include her daughter Claire (Coco Sad). "That's a really big turning point for Alison," said Laborampman. "It's a real look at how much she was immersed in taking over the traumatic and collapsing emotional state."

The first two seasons of the series were Alison and Luther. This moment is especially noteworthy, as it has a significant impact on the romance between them. Other members of the Umbrella Academy enjoyed teasing Luther in love with his "sister" (actually irrelevant, they just grew up together), but in Season 1 It turns out that Alison is away from her husband. Relationship with Pinning Luther; and in Season 2, she married a man in 1963, before reuniting with other members of the team. In Season 3, Alison left her husband in 1963 and lost her daughter to Shenanigan on the timeline. Perhaps the limit, Luther is now with Sloan (Genesis Rodriguez), a member of the Sparrow Academy.

"She always had Luther, even when she wasn't getting along with others in her family, even when everything had collapsed in the last few seasons." Labor Lampman said. "They always had this understanding and this connection she didn't really have with anyone else, and when she betrayed him like this, it's really, really painful."

And when it leaves things, the romance between Alison and Luther seems to have taken place forever. By the end of the season, Luther had married Sloan (although she would be missing after the timeline was reset), and Allison had been her husband since 1963. Reunited with Rei (Yusuf Gatewood) and her daughter. But this moment in episode 5 completely obscures everything.

"In a sense, it's because we're saying that it shouldn't really be the case," Hopper said. "I felt it was wrong because it wasn't right and happened at multiple levels, but that's not what they really want. It's like the weird kind of security blanket they have. So it comes out in a completely different and abusive way from both sides. "

Raver-Lampman agreed, adding: "I think we played Luther and Allison's romantic beats, and I also think they both found a deeper, more complete, real love. Luther / Allison It was never an amorous relationship. It was just this really deep connection, but they actually found desire and love with other people ... it's just different. They always have a special connection. But that part of the romance is probably dead, and it's probably Alison's fault. ”
